Brand Bourdin, Switzerland
Year Circa 1870
Case No. 6008
Caliber 43 mm., mate gilt, standing barrels for the going and striking trains, repeating barrel wound by the slide on the band, 37 jewels, lateral lever escapement with banking by two pins, cut bimetallic compensation balance with gold meantime and temperature adjustment screws, blued steel Breguet balance spring with overcoil, index regulator, striking with two hammers on two gongs and repeating with two further hammers on two further gongs.
Diameter 54 mm.
Weight 175 gr.
Signature Cuvette signed Repassée par Bourdin.
